Show : THE ZEPHYR/FEBRU WHEN THE RCH 2006 CHANGE IS AN IMPROVEMENT DEMISE of the ATLAS MILL THE ATLAS MILL built in the early 60s by Charlie Steen was once the largest employer in Grand County. In the early 80s, when the price of uranium plummmeted, the mill shut down, a fourth of Moab's work force found themselves out of work, and Moab began its transformation from the "Uranium Capital of the World" to the "Mountain Bike Capital of the World" to the "Quick Condo Capital of the World." When the top photo was taken, the demolition of the mill had already begun. Today the mill is gone and the government is about to begin removal of the adjacent tailings pile to a safer location near Crescent Jct. What will become of the land, once the toxic pile is remove and the site deemed safe? We can HOPE for a park, but the real estate there will be worth millions. Will we someday see the Atlas Hilton & Golf Course?
